Where Is Fashion Headed This Year In India
by Rashmi Adwani health content developmentWith a strong and emerging fashion industry, India is all set to set new standards in the world of fashion. Taking cues from Lakme Fashion Week Summer, we look at the dominant trends in India's fashion industry for the year of 2018.
Sustainable Fashion Is Still Trending
For the 13th time in a row, Lakme Fashion Week dedicated an whole afternoon to Sustainable Fashion.
However, the simple fact that the notion is quickly getting mainstreamed was clear in the collections of leading designers such as Rajesh Pratap Singh, that experimented with new cloths which are eco-conscious.
Monochrome Is Still In Style
By GenNext designers to star designers such as Shantanu and Nikhil, and Narendra Kumar, vogue at LFW was dominantly white and black this year.
Jayanti Reddy went a step further and called her group Life in Monochrome.
It is not (only ) about Fashion Designers
In fact, no, the fashion business isn't about indian fashion designers. Well, not just about them. There is a whole array of different functions in the business which makes what we find on the runways and in malls.
The fashion business in India, exactly like in every other nation can also be about style photography, pattern making, garment construction, accessory design, make-up musicians, modelling, cloth weaving, fabric research and development, style journalism/editorial, and production to name a couple.
Fashion designers are merely a small part of the whole game. In India, other businesses like manufacturing material, exporting and importing fabrics, embroidery and dyeing constitute a much larger percentage of this business.
The fashion designer only has to use these available tools to present new designs to the industry. So yes, if you are thinking about a career in the fashion business, fantastic news isthat the choices aren't confined to fashion design.
Silver Is The New Gold
Silver is indeed in that filmmaker Karan Johar dyed his hair from the shade to its Falguni Shane Peocock collection. Undoubtedly, silver is the new gold.
Flowers Still Rock
Flowers are still in fashion! "Garden of flowers" from Anita Dongre, "Mid Summer Wreath" from Ravi Bhalotia and "Lost in the Woods" from Agami, point to one simple fact - that flowers are still in fashion!
